INSERTING BATTERIES This camera is powered by two 1.5-volt alkaline or silver-oxide mini-batteries. • Open the battery chamber cover by turning it counter-clockwise with a coin. • Insert the two batteries into the chamber with their (+) sides facing downward, and replace the cover. • As illustrated, turn the meter on by sliding the main switch in the direction of the arrow. 0 11 76
